TX2运行ImageNet

来源:互联网 发布:cnki数据库 编辑:程序博客网 时间:2024/06/03 20:33

写在最前

先上jetson官方教程,英文的:Building from Source on Jetson
基本上按照这个教程来可以完成所有工作,前提是,你生活在没有墙的世界里。因为如果被q的话,会在cmake ../这一步的时候卡住,因为要从nvidia的某个网站下载已经训练好的模型,但是这个网站是在墙内无法访问的。因此,其实,这个教程是教大家科学上网的?

有个能fq的服务器

继续给好老师打广告:Shadowsocks科学上网
这里的重点就是:
1. 安装shadowsocks
sudo pip install shadowsocks
2. 编辑好配置文件,保存到~/ss.json

{"server":"服务器 IP 地址", #VPS的IP地址"server_port":8388, #监听的端口"local_address": "127.0.0.1", #本地监听的IP地址,默认为主机"local_port":1080, #本地监听的端口"password":"mypassword", #服务密码"timeout":300, #超时设置"method":"aes-256-cfb" #加密方法,推荐 "aes-256-cfb"}

3.运行起来shadowsocks
/usr/local/bin/sslocal -c ~/ss.json

命令行里运行

虽然经过上面的设置你的浏览器(可能)能出去看看,但是我们需要在命令行里通过wget等命令来进行http请求还需要一些过程。
1. 安装proxychans4
下载代码:
git clone https://github.com/rofl0r/proxychains-ng.git
安装:

./configure --prefix=/usr --sysconfdir=/etcsudo make installsudo make install-config

安装好了还需要设置一下
sudo gedit /etc/proxychains.conf
在最后加上:socks5 127.0.0.1 1082,而且要注意,如果有socks4之类的这种话,注释掉!
2. 安装polipo
sudo apt-get install polipo
向默认的配置文件/etc/polipo/config里添加如下内容:

logSyslog = truelogFile = /var/log/polipo/polipo.log# 下面是添加的部分proxyAddress = "0.0.0.0"proxyPort = 1081socksParentProxy = "127.0.0.1:1082"socksProxyType = socks5

这个1082是你刚才设置的那个,然后1081是选择转发的。
然后再运行sudo polipo
3. 最后,一定要记住这样运行proxychains cmake ../,应该就木有问题了。

原创粉丝点击